Centre has agreed to establish AIIMS in Kozhikode: Kerala minister
Hospitality and Healthcare - Jul 02,2024 -Kerala Health Minister Veena George has informed the state assembly that the Centre has accepted the proposal to set up an AIIMS at Kinalur in Kozhikode.
150 acres of land belonging to the industries department at Kinalur has been acquired for AIIMS. Veena George said that steps to acquire the remaining 50 acres are in the final stage.
The Kozhikode Medical College has been a major super-speciality hospital in the government sector catering to 1.46 crore people in six northern districts. Around 9,000 patients visit the hospital daily, which is three times its actual capacity, even forcing patients to lie in corridors.
Moreover, the Kozhikode MCH is struggling with a severe staff shortage. The hospital’s ratio of nurses, nursing assistants, and doctors per patient is very low.
Despite allocating the ‘Pradhan Mantri Swasthya Suraksha Yojana’ Block, and Tertiary Cancer Care Centre, the hospital is still grappling with issues like overcrowding and staff shortage, which highlights the necessity of a referral system.
